[C# 문법] C# 컬렉션 Hashtable (해시 테이블) 사용 예제
- C#/C# 문법
- 2020. 1. 31. 11:34
안녕하세요.
오늘은 C# 에서 기본으로 제공해주는 컬렉션 중 하나인 Hashtable 사용방법에 대해서 알아 보려고 합니다.
Hashtable은 키와 값의 쌍으로 이루어진 데이터를 다룰 때 유용한 자료구조 입니다.
다른 부연 설명 없이 바로 예제를 통해서 어떻게 사용을 하는지 보여드리도록 하겠습니다.
예제 코드
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 |
using System; using System.Collections; using System.Collections.Generic; using System.Linq; using System.Text; using System.Threading.Tasks;
namespace HashtableTest { class Program { static void Main(string[] args) { //Hashtable 객체 선언 Hashtable ht = new Hashtable();
//선언한 객체에 데이터 저장하기 ht.Add("하나", "one"); ht.Add("둘", "two"); ht.Add("셋", "three"); ht.Add("넷", "four"); ht.Add("다섯", "five");
//저장된 객체 출력하기 foreach(var value in ht.Keys) { Console.WriteLine("{0} : {1}", value, ht[value]); } } } }
|
실행 결과
해시 테이블 사용 방법은 크게 어려운 점은 없기 때문에 예제 코드를 따라 쳐 보시면서 익히시면 바로 응용하실 수 있으실 거에요!
글 읽어 주셔서 감사합니다.^^
'C# > C# 문법' 카테고리의 다른 글
[C# 문법] C# 익명메서드 선언방법 (0) | 2020.02.05 |
---|---|
[C# 문법] C# 인덱서(Indexer) 사용 방법 (2) | 2020.01.31 |
[C# 문법] StringBuilder 클래스 이용하여 문자열 연결하기 (0) | 2020.01.13 |
[C# 문법] C# Dictionary(딕셔너리) 사용시, “동일한 키를 사용하는 항목이 이미 추가되었습니다.” 에러 해결 방법 (0) | 2020.01.08 |
[C# 문법] C# DataTable 에서 ColumnName(컬럼이름) 얻어오는 방법 (0) | 2020.01.05 |
이 글을 공유하기